DEFINITIONS5
NOUN
1
ADJECTIVEA substance that destroys micro-organisms that carry disease without harming body tissues.
1
Clean and honest.
“antiseptic financial practices”
2
Devoid of objectionable language.
“lyrics as antiseptic as Sunday School”
3
Freeing from error or corruption.
“the antiseptic effect of sturdy criticism”
4
Thoroughly clean and free of or destructive to disease-causing organisms.
“doctors in antiseptic green coats”
“the antiseptic effect of alcohol”
